Abstract

A six speed transmission is provided that includes three planetary gear sets having a common carrier member and six torque-transmitting mechanisms operated in combinations of two to provide at least six forward speed ratios and two reverse speed ratios. A method of assembling a transmission is also provided. A reduction in components and component standardization is achieved.

Claims (42)

1. A multi-speed transmission comprising:

an input shaft;

an output shaft;

first, second and third planetary gear sets having a common carrier member, at least two ring gear members, and each having a sun gear member;

a plurality of sets of pinion gears rotatably mounted on said common carrier member intermeshing with said ring gear members and said sun gear members;

said input shaft not being continuously connected with any member of said planetary gear sets and said output shaft being continuously connected with a member of said planetary gear sets; and

six torque-transmitting mechanisms operable for selectively interconnecting said members of said planetary gear sets with said input shaft, with a stationary member or with other members of said planetary gear sets, said six torque-transmitting mechanisms being engaged in combinations of two to establish at least six forward speed ratios and two reverse speed ratios between said input shaft and said output shaft.

2. The multi-speed transmission of claim 1 , further comprising:

an interconnecting member continuously interconnecting said sun gear member of one of said planetary gear sets with said sun gear member of another of said planetary gear sets.

3. The multi-speed transmission of claim 1 , wherein one of said ring gear members intermeshes with both a first set and a second set of said plurality of sets of pinion gears, said first set being members of said first planetary gear set and said second set being members of said second planetary gear set.

4. The multi-speed transmission of claim 1 , wherein each pinion gear of said plurality of sets of pinion gears is characterized by a predetermined number of teeth and rotates on a respective spindle mounted on said common carrier member at a respective bearing, each of said respective spindles and said respective bearings being characterized by a predetermined spindle size and each of said respective bearings being characterized by a predetermined bearing size.

5. The multi-speed transmission of claim 1 , wherein a first of said six torque-transmitting mechanisms is operable for selectively interconnecting said sun gear member of said second planetary gear set and said sun gear member of said third planetary gear set with said input shaft.

6. The multi-speed transmission of claim 1 , wherein a second of said six torque-transmitting mechanisms is operable for selectively interconnecting said common carrier member with said input shaft.

7. The multi-speed transmission of claim 1 , wherein a third of said six torque-transmitting mechanisms is operable for selectively interconnecting said input shaft with said sun gear member of said first planetary gear set.

8. The multi-speed transmission of claim 1 , wherein a fourth of said six torque-transmitting mechanisms is operable for selectively interconnecting said sun gear member of said first planetary gear set with said stationary member.

9. The multi-speed transmission of claim 1 , wherein a first of said at least two ring gear members is a member of said first and second planetary gear sets; and

wherein a fifth of said torque-transmitting mechanisms is operable for selectively interconnecting said first of said at least two ring gear members with said stationary member.

10. The multi-speed transmission of claim 1 , wherein a second of said at least two ring gear members is a member of said third planetary gear set; and

wherein a sixth of said six torque-transmitting mechanisms is operable for selectively interconnecting said common carrier member with said stationary member.

11. A multi-speed transmission comprising:

an input shaft;

an output shaft;

first, second and third planetary gear sets having a common carrier member, each having a sun gear member, said first and second planetary gear sets having at least one ring gear member and said third planetary gear set having another ring gear member, said sun gear member of said second planetary gear set being continuously connected with said sun gear member of said third planetary gear set;

said input shaft not being continuously connected with any member of said planetary gear sets and said output shaft being continuously connected with said ring gear member of said third planetary gear set;

a first torque-transmitting mechanism operable for selectively interconnecting said sun gear member of said second planetary gear set with said input shaft;

a second torque-transmitting mechanism operable for selectively interconnecting said common carrier member with said input shaft;

a third torque-transmitting mechanism operable for selectively interconnecting said sun gear member of said first planetary gear set with said input shaft;

a fourth torque-transmitting mechanism operable for selectively interconnecting said sun gear member of said first planetary gear set with said stationary member;

a fifth torque-transmitting mechanism operable for selectively interconnecting said at least one ring gear member of said first and second planetary gear sets with said stationary member;

a sixth torque-transmitting mechanism for selectively interconnecting said common carrier member with said stationary member; and

said six torque-transmitting mechanisms being operable in combinations of two to provide six forward speed ratios and two reverse speed ratios.

12. The multi-speed transmission of claim 11 , wherein said at least one ring gear member of said first and second planetary gear sets is a single ring gear member interconnecting both with pinion gears of said first planetary gear set and pinion gears of said second planetary gear set.

13. The multi-speed transmission of claim 11 , wherein said at least one ring gear member includes a first ring gear member of said first planetary gear set and a second ring gear member of said second planetary gear set, said transmission further comprising:

an interconnecting member continuously interconnecting said first ring gear member of said first planetary gear set with said second ring gear member of said second planetary gear set.

14. The multi-speed transmission of claim 11 , further comprising:

five sets of pinion gears rotatably mounted on said common carrier member;

a first and a second of said five sets of pinion gears intermeshing with said at least on ring gear member of said first and second planetary gear sets and with said sun gear member of said first planetary gear set, respectively, and with one another;

a third of said five sets of pinion gears intermeshing both with said at least one ring gear member of said first and second planetary gear sets and said sun gear member of said second planetary gear set; and

a fourth and a fifth of said five sets of pinion gears intermeshing both with said ring gear member of said third planetary gear set and said sun gear member of said third planetary gear set, respectively, and with one another.

15. The multi-speed transmission of claim 11 , further comprising:

a park lock gear continuously interconnected with said ring gear member of said third planetary gear set and with said output member.

16. The multi-speed transmission of claim 11 , wherein said third torque-transmitting mechanism is disposed radially inward of said first and second torque-transmitting mechanisms, wherein said third torque-transmitting mechanism is characterized by higher speeds than said first and second torque-transmitting mechanisms, said radially inward disposition of said third torque-transmitting mechanism thereby minimizing spin losses.
